Why Alignment Matters

You might be wondering, “What does aligning data with business objectives really mean?” Well, think of it this way: if data is a compass, the business objectives are our true north. Only by ensuring that the data points us in the right direction can we truly leverage it for insightful decision-making.

Picture a company that's newly set on enhancing customer satisfaction. Suddenly, data on customer feedback becomes incredibly relevant—almost like finding a treasure map that leads you straight to the gold. However, if that company were to focus its efforts on outdated data regarding product features rather than contemporary customer interactions, it risks sailing in the wrong direction. Misguided decisions could not only waste resources but might also disrupt team morale and affect overall customer relations.

Factors Influencing Data Relevance

While this focus on alignment is vital, let’s not dismiss other aspects entirely. Accessibility is crucial; if your data can't be easily accessed by team members who need it, then it might as well be locked away in a vault. Similarly, frequent updates ensure that the data reflects the most current information—sort of like moving from a flip phone to the latest smartphone; the upgrades make a world of difference!

Then there's compliance with legal standards. It’s essential for protecting the organization from potential legal pitfalls. However, compliance alone doesn't ensure that your data is impactful or relevant to your strategies. Navigating the Data Landscape

So, how do we ensure our data remains aligned with our business objectives? It starts with regular check-ins. Businesses should routinely assess their objectives and the supporting data. Is there a shift in strategy? Maybe a new project on the horizon? Regularly revisiting alignment ensures organizations remain on course.

Also, consider incorporating a feedback loop among teams that rely on data. Opening the floor for discussion about what's working—and what's not—can provide invaluable insights.
